* {
	font-family: Arial, Verdana, Helvetica, sans-serif;
	outline: none;
}
body {
	background-color: #FFFFFF;
}
p, span, td, th, li {
	font-size: 12px;
	color: #000000;
}
p {
	margin:	0 0 10px 0;
	padding: 0;
}
.btnheaderbold {
	color: #FFFFFF;
	font-weight: bold;
	font-size: 16px;
}
.homeheaderbold {
	color: #a30501;
	font-weight: bold;
	font-size: 16px;
}
.style2 {
	font-size: 12px;
	color: #FFFFFF;
	
}
.smalltext {
	font-size: 10px;
	color: #FFFFFF;
	line-height: 13pt;
}
.products {
	color: #FFFFFF;
	text-decoration: none;
	line-height: 13pt;
		
}
.products a {
	color: #FFFFFF;
	text-decoration: none;
}
.products a:hover {
	color: #073c5e;
	text-decoration: underline;
}
.services {
	color: #FFFFFF;
	text-decoration: none;
	line-height: 13pt;
	padding: 25px 10px 15px 15px;
		
}
.services a {
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
}
.services a:hover {
	color: #d98a88;
	text-decoration: underline;

}
.pdflinks {
	color: #0060ff;
	text-decoration: none;
	font-weight: bold;
	line-height: 13pt;
}
.pdflinks a {
	font-size: 11px;
	color: #0060ff;
	text-decoration: none;
}

.pdflinks a:hover {
	color: #d98a88;
	text-decoration: underline;
}
.footercopy {
	font-size: 11px;
	color: #aaa8a8;
	text-decoration: none;
}
.footercopy a {
	font-size: 11px;
	color: #aaa8a8;
	text-decoration: none;
}
.footercopy a:hover {
	text-decoration: underline;
}

/* ALIGNMENTS */
	.cal {text-align:center;}
	.left {text-align:left;}
	.ral {text-align:right;}
	.tvert {vertical-align:top;}
	.mvert {vertical-align:middle;}
	.mcal {vertical-align:middle;text-align:center;}
	.tcal {vertical-align:top;text-align:center;}
	.tral {vertical-align:top;text-align:right;}
	.tleft {vertical-align:top;text-align:left;}
/* END ALIGNMENTS */
/* Table  */
	.content_main {
		margin: 10px auto 0 auto;
		width: 651px;
		}
/* End Table  */

/* td  */
	.content_main_td {
		padding: 9px;
		vertical-align: top;
		}
/* End td  */

/* Div  */
	div.set_content {
		margin: 0;
		padding: 0;
		width: 100%;
		min-height: 394px;
		height: auto !important;
		height: 394px;
}
		
		#menu {
		background: #000;
		margin: 0 0 0 0;
		padding: 0;
		width: 950px;
		
}
/* End div  */

#menu ul{
margin: 0;
padding: 0;
width: 950px;}

#menu ul li{
display: inline;
margin: 0;
padding: 0;
list-style: none;}

#menu ul li a{
display: block;
float: left;
margin: 0;
padding: 18px 0px 14px 26px;
line-height: 100%;
font-size: 13px;
color: #FFFFFF;
font-weight: bold;
text-decoration: none;
background: #000;
outline: none;
}
#menu ul li a:hover{
color: #61c5ff;
text-decoration: underline;}

.body_copy{
padding: 0;
margin: 20px auto 10px auto;
width: 90%; }

.imgBanner{
margin: 0;
padding: 0;}

/* STANDARD HEADER */
	h1, h2, h3, h4, h5, h6 {
		color:#666666;
		margin: 0 0 5px 0;
		padding: 0;
		font-weight: bold;
		}
	h1 {font-size:16px;}
	
	h2 {font-size:14px;}
	
	h3 {font-size:14px;
		color:#0772ba;}
		
	h4 {font-size:10px;}
	
	h5 {font-size:10px;
		color:#99a0ab;
		}
/* END STANDARD HEADER */

.float_right{
float: right;}

.img_enews{
margin-top: 49px;}

.body_home {
padding: 0;
margin: 0px auto 5px auto;
width: 90%; }

.sub_nav_bg{
background: #3ea1e4 url("images/ardus_productsarea2.jpg") 0 -14px no-repeat;}

.sub_nav2_bg{
background: #3ea1e4 url("images/ardus_products_nav_btn.jpg") no-repeat;}

.readmorelinks{
font-size:10px;
color:#0060ff;
font-weight: bold;
text-decoration: underline;
}

.backbutton{
font-size:10px;
color:#990000;
font-weight: bold;
text-decoration: underline;
}

.redheader{
font-size:12px;
color:#990000;
font-weight: bold;
}

#breadcrumb ul li{
	padding: 0 3px 0 0;
	margin: 3px 0 0 0;
	list-style-image: none;
	display:inline;
	font-size: 8pt;
	color: #00467f;
}
	
#breadcrumb ul li a, ul.subcatlist li a {
	color: #00467f;
}

#breadcrumb ul {
	margin: 0;
	padding: 0;
}
	
#sitesearch {
	margin: 0;
	padding: 0;
}

/* adds the red gradient background to the left column in the main table */
.backgroundRepeat {
	background-image: url("images/background_shim.gif");
}
/* titles for the product specs */
#productSpecs {
}
.productSpecs p {
	padding-bottom: 2px;
}
.specTitle {
	font-weight: bold;
	padding-bottom: 1px;
}

#productdetails {
}
	#productdetails h1 {
		padding-bottom: 8px;
	}
	#productdetails p {
		padding-bottom: 5px;
	}
	#productdetails img {
		float: right;
		padding: 0 0 12px 15px;
	}
	#productdetails h3 {
		padding-bottom: 10px;
		font-size:14px;
		color:#0772ba;
	}
	#productdetails ul {
		list-style-type: none;
		margin: 0;
		padding: 0 0 10px 0;
	}
		#productdetails li {
			padding-bottom: 3px;
		}
	/*#productdetails ul.indented {
		list-style-type: disc;
		margin-left: 5px;
		padding-bottom: 5px;
	}
		#productdetails li.indented {
			padding-bottom: 4px;
		}*/